2001See Holmes v. Turlington, 480 So.2d 150 *279 (Fla. 1st DCA 1985)(deviation from a standard of conduct is essentially an ultimate finding of fact clearly within the realm of the hearing officer's fact-finding discretion).

1993In Holmes v. Turlington, 480 So.2d 150, 153 (Fla. 1st DCA 1985), we held that "deviation from a standard of conduct is essentially an ultimate finding of fact clearly within the realm of the hearing officer's fact-finding discretion." The administrative rules on which the School Board based its rejection of the recommended order constitute the same sort of provisions governing professional conduct as were involved and discussed in Holmes .
